MANILA — Manila Mayor Honey Lacuna and her re-election rival Isko Moreno cast their votes at separate schools for the 2025 national and local elections.

Moreno, former mayor of the capital, expressed confidence after casting his vote at the Manuel Quezon Elementary School in Tondo, Manila.

“Iyong confidence andun naman, but I think most of you here kilala ang ugali ko na no letup ako, whether trabaho, sa taumbayan o gobyerno o sa anumang bagay hangga't 'di tapos ang laban,” Moreno said.

He said that throughout the campaign, he maintained a positive attitude despite the intense race for the top post in Manila.

“Wala kayong nakitang negativity, in fact all things thrown at us, well explained publicly, in caucuses,” Moreno said.

His rival, re-electionist Mayor Lacuna voted at Legarda Elementary School in Sampaloc past 9 a.m.

“Relieved po tayo na tapos na ang kampanya, nakaboto na rin tayo. Relieved po,” she shared in an interview.

Lacuna assured Manila residents of her continued dedication to their welfare, promising to serve even better if given a fresh mandate.

“Unang una po, pag ako ay muli nahalal—pasalamat po sa lahat ng naniwala sa isang tapat na tagapaglingkod. Asahan ninyo hinding-hindi kayo papabayaan. Marami pa tayo kailangan tapusin at gawin,” she said.
